Spasticity is a condition in which muscles become stiff and tight from contracting for long periods. It's usually caused by conditions that affect the central nervous system, which is responsible ...
Spasticity results in involuntary contractions of synergistic muscles in the extremities, which are clinically manifested as flexor or extensor spasms (Mayer & Esquenazi, 2003; Meythaler, 2001).
